The Apgar score is based on which 5 parameters?.
Heart rate, respiratory effort.
Temperature, tone.
And color.
Heart rate, breaths per minute, irritability, tone, and color.
The Correct Answer is D
The correct answer is choice D.
Choice A rationale:
Heart rate and respiratory effort are two of the five parameters of the Apgar score. However, this choice is incomplete as it does not include all five parameters.
Choice B rationale:
Temperature is not a parameter of the Apgar score. Tone is a parameter, but this choice is incomplete as it does not include all five parameters.
Choice C rationale:
Color is a parameter of the Apgar score. However, this choice is incomplete as it does not include all five parameters.
Choice D rationale:
The Apgar score is based on five parameters: heart rate, breaths per minute (respiratory effort), irritability (response to stimulation), tone (muscle tone), and color. Therefore, this choice is correct.
